[
#============================================================================
        {'dirname':'start', 'requires+': ['../other_runs']},
        {'dirname':'other_runs',
         'requires': ["../common", "../base", "../", "../input", "../acc", "../dbcsrwrap", "../pw", "../mpiwrap", "../subsys", "../force_eval","../fm",],
         'files': ["ipi_driver.F",
                   "optimize_basis.F",
                   "cp2k_debug.F",
                   "optimize_input.F",
                   "mode_selective.F"
                  ]
         },

#============================================================================
        {'dirname':'start',  'requires+': ['../force_eval']},
        {'dirname':'swarm',  'requires+': ['../force_eval']},
        {'dirname':'tmc',    'requires+': ['../force_eval']},
        {'dirname':'motion', 'requires+': ['../force_eval']},

        {'dirname':'force_eval',
         'requires': ["../common", "../base", "../", "../input", "../acc", "../dbcsrwrap", "../pw", "../mpiwrap", "../subsys", "../fm"],
         'files': ["force_env_methods.F",
                   "force_env_types.F",
                   "force_env_utils.F",
                   "f77_interface.F",
                   "input_restart_force_eval.F",
                   "replica_methods.F",
                   "replica_types.F",

                    # consequence of f77 hack
                   "ep_types.F",
                   "ep_methods.F",
                   "ep_f77_low.F",

                   ]
        },

#============================================================================
        {'dirname':'motion', 'requires+': ['../strain']},
        {'dirname':'force_eval', 'requires+': ['../strain']},

        {'dirname':'strain',
         'requires': ["../common", "../base", "../", "../input", "../acc", "../dbcsrwrap", "../pw", "../mpiwrap", "../subsys"],
         'files': ["restraint.F",
                   "colvar_methods.F",
                   "constraint_clv.F",
                   "constraint.F",
                   "constraint_vsite.F",
                   "constraint_fxd.F",
                   "constraint_util.F",
                   "constraint_3x3.F",
                   "constraint_4x6.F",
                   ]
        },


#============================================================================
        {'dirname':'motion',
         'files': [
                   "colvar_utils.F",
                   "metadynamics_utils.F",
                   "metadynamics.F",
                   "motion_utils.F",
                   "optimize_input.F",
                   "mode_selective.F",
                   ]
        },

]
#EOF
